Food Packaging Barrier Film Sales Market Outlook

The global food packaging barrier film sales market is projected to reach approximately USD 11.5 billion by 2035, with a compound annual growth rate (CAGR) of around 5.8% during the forecast period from 2025 to 2035. This growth can be attributed to the increasing demand for packaged food products, the rising consumer preference for convenience foods, and the growing awareness regarding food safety and shelf-life extension. As the food industry expands, manufacturers are focusing on developing innovative packaging solutions that enhance product integrity and reduce spoilage. Furthermore, advancements in barrier film technology are contributing to the market's expansion, allowing for improved moisture and oxygen barrier properties which are critical for various food products.

By Product Type

PE-based Films:

PE-based films are widely utilized in the food packaging sector due to their excellent flexibility and moisture barrier properties. These films are especially popular for packaging applications that require high durability and resistance to punctures, making them ideal for items like fresh produce, bakery goods, and deli products. The ease of processing and low production costs associated with PE films further enhance their appeal to manufacturers. The growing trend of flexible packaging among brands seeking to reduce their environmental footprint also supports the increased use of PE-based films in the market. With shifting consumer preferences toward sustainable packaging solutions, innovation in the formulation of PE films to include recycled materials is expected to boost their market presence.

PP-based Films:

PP-based films, known for their excellent clarity and heat resistance, are commonly used in packaging applications involving meat, dairy, and snacks. These films provide a superior barrier against moisture and gases, which is crucial for maintaining the freshness and longevity of perishable food items. The inherent recyclability of polypropylene is another factor driving its demand in the food packaging sector as consumers and manufacturers alike are increasingly focused on sustainability. Additionally, the ability of PP films to be easily printed upon allows for attractive branding and product differentiation in a competitive market. As food manufacturers innovate in product presentation and packaging aesthetics, the use of PP-based films is anticipated to rise significantly.

PET-based Films:

PET-based films are recognized for their outstanding barrier properties against oxygen, moisture, and UV light, making them a preferred choice for packaging sensitive food products, including snacks and ready meals. The strength and dimensional stability of PET films facilitate their use in various packaging formats such as pouches, trays, and lidding films. Additionally, PET films can be produced with a low thickness without compromising their functional properties, enhancing their economic viability. The increasing demand for transparent and visually appealing packaging is also contributing to the growth of PET films in the food industry. As sustainability remains a key concern, the development of recycled PET films is likely to gain traction in the market.

EVOH-based Films:

EVOH-based films are renowned for their exceptional oxygen barrier properties, making them ideal for packaging applications where oxygen control is critical, such as meats and cheese. Their ability to maintain the freshness and quality of packaged food products plays a significant role in reducing food waste. The versatility of EVOH films allows them to be coextruded with other materials, enhancing their performance characteristics while also providing strength and durability. As the emphasis on reducing food spoilage grows, the demand for EVOH-based films is expected to witness steady growth in the food packaging market. Furthermore, ongoing innovations in EVOH technology may lead to new formulations that enhance barrier performance and sustainability.

Others:

This category encompasses a variety of other barrier film types, which may include materials like nylon and other custom-engineered films tailored for specific food packaging needs. These films offer unique advantages such as high-performance barriers against various gases and moisture, making them suitable for specialty food products, including gourmet items and organic foods. The increasing trend toward niche and artisanal food products is likely to fuel the demand for such specialized barrier films. Moreover, advancements in material science may lead to the development of hybrid films that combine the beneficial properties of different polymers, offering enhanced functionalities for a diverse range of food applications.

By Application

Meat:

The meat packaging segment is one of the largest segments in the food packaging barrier film market, primarily driven by the need for maintaining freshness and extending shelf life. Barrier films used in meat packaging often feature superior moisture and gas barrier properties, which are crucial for preventing spoilage and maintaining the quality of fresh meats. As consumers become increasingly health-conscious, the demand for high-quality, minimally processed meat products has surged, leading to an uptick in the use of advanced packaging solutions. Furthermore, innovations in packaging technology, such as vacuum packaging and modified atmosphere packaging, are enhancing the preservation of meat products, thereby bolstering the growth of this segment.

Poultry:

Poultry packaging is closely linked to the meat segment, as it requires similar barrier film characteristics to protect the product from spoilage and contamination. The growing consumption of poultry products, driven by their perceived health benefits and versatility, is driving the demand for effective packaging solutions. Poultry packaging films must offer robust protection against moisture and oxygen to maintain product integrity during storage and transportation. As the poultry market evolves with an increasing focus on organic and free-range options, the need for specialized barrier films that cater to these products is also gaining prominence. Innovations such as breathable films that allow for optimal gas exchange are likely to enhance the appeal of poultry packaging solutions.

Seafood:

The seafood packaging segment requires highly effective barrier films to ensure the freshness and safety of delicate products like fish and shellfish. Seafood is particularly vulnerable to spoilage due to its high moisture content, making the selection of suitable packaging materials crucial. Barrier films used for seafood must provide excellent moisture control and oxygen barrier properties, which are essential for maintaining quality and extending shelf life. Additionally, as consumers become more health-conscious and demand fresh seafood options, the market for seafood packaging solutions is expected to expand. Innovations in sustainable seafood packaging are also gaining traction, leading to increased demand for eco-friendly barrier films.

Dairy:

The dairy packaging segment is focused on utilizing barrier films that protect products like milk, cheese, and yogurt from spoilage and contamination. The necessity for effective barrier properties is heightened in dairy products due to their perishable nature. Packaging solutions must ensure the retention of moisture while preventing oxygen ingress, which can accelerate spoilage. Increasing consumer demand for convenient and portable dairy products is driving innovations in packaging formats, including pouches and cups, which utilize advanced barrier films to enhance usability. Moreover, the growing trend of plant-based dairy alternatives is creating new opportunities for barrier film innovations tailored to these products.

Bakery & Confectionery:

In the bakery and confectionery sector, barrier films play a critical role in preserving freshness and preventing staleness of products like bread, cakes, and candies. As consumers increasingly seek out convenient snack options, the demand for flexible packaging solutions that maintain product quality is on the rise. Barrier films used in this segment often feature exceptional moisture control properties to prevent product degradation. Additionally, the aesthetic appeal of packaging plays an important role in attracting consumers, which is why many manufacturers are investing in barrier films that allow for high-quality printing and branding. The growth of the bakery and confectionery market is thus directly correlated with advancements in barrier film technology.

Others:

This segment includes various food applications that require specialized barrier films, such as snacks, sauces, and frozen foods. Each of these applications has unique packaging requirements that demand tailored barrier solutions. For instance, snacks often require barrier films that retain crunchiness, while sauces necessitate films that protect against moisture and contamination. The diversification of food products and consumer preferences for ready-to-eat and frozen meals are driving the demand for versatile barrier films. As the market evolves, manufacturers are likely to develop innovative solutions that cater specifically to these diverse applications, enhancing the overall growth of the food packaging barrier film market.

By Packaging Type

Pouches:

Pouches are becoming increasingly popular in the food packaging sector due to their convenience and versatility. They offer an excellent solution for a variety of food products, including snacks, frozen items, and even liquids. The use of barrier films in pouches ensures that the products remain fresh and protected from external factors, such as moisture and oxygen. Additionally, the lightweight nature of pouches contributes to lower shipping costs and reduced environmental impact. As consumer preferences shift towards on-the-go products, the demand for pouches is expected to continue growing, prompting manufacturers to innovate with new materials and designs that enhance convenience and functionality in food packaging.

Bags:

Plastic bags are extensively used for various food packaging applications, especially for dry goods, grains, and bulk food items. The demand for barrier films in bags is increasing, particularly for products that require moisture protection and oxygen barriers, such as cereals and snacks. Barrier films enhance the shelf life of these foods by preventing staleness and spoilage. With a surge in online food shopping, bags are also being used in e-commerce packaging, further driving their demand. Manufacturers are continuously developing new bag types that incorporate advanced barrier films to meet the evolving market needs while also focusing on sustainability by integrating recyclable materials into bag production.

Wraps:

Wraps are another popular packaging type that utilizes barrier films, particularly for fresh produce, meats, and cheeses. They are designed to provide an efficient solution for preserving freshness while allowing for visibility of the product. Barrier films used in wraps must possess excellent moisture and oxygen barrier properties to prevent spoilage and maintain product quality. The increasing interest in fresh and organic food products is driving the demand for wraps as they offer a convenient way to package perishable items without compromising quality. Innovations in wrap technology, such as breathable films that allow for gas exchange, are further enhancing their appeal in the food packaging market.

Lidding Films:

Lidding films are primarily used in prepared meal trays and containers, providing a protective seal over food products. These films offer an effective barrier against moisture and oxygen, ensuring the freshness and safety of the packaged food. The convenience of lidding films, which allows for easy opening and resealing, is driving their demand in the market. With the growing trend of meal kits and ready-to-eat meals, the need for reliable lidding solutions is expected to increase. Manufacturers are innovating with new materials that enhance the barrier properties of lidding films while also focusing on sustainability to cater to environmentally conscious consumers.

Others:

This category includes a variety of other food packaging types that employ barrier films, such as trays, containers, and specialized packaging solutions. Each application has unique requirements that necessitate tailored barrier properties to ensure product integrity. The rise of gourmet and artisanal food products is also contributing to the demand for customized packaging solutions that provide both aesthetic appeal and functional benefits. As the market evolves, manufacturers are likely to develop hybrid packaging types that combine the advantages of different film materials, enhancing their overall performance in food preservation and safety.

By Material Type

Plastic:

Plastic barrier films dominate the food packaging market due to their versatility, durability, and cost-effectiveness. They are extensively used for various applications, including flexible pouches, bags, and wraps. Plastic films, particularly those made from polyethylene (PE) and polypropylene (PP), offer excellent moisture and oxygen barrier properties that help maintain product freshness. The lightweight nature of plastic films also contributes to lower transportation costs, making them an attractive choice for manufacturers. As sustainability becomes a key concern, there is a growing trend towards developing recyclable and biodegradable plastic films, which is expected to shape the future of this material segment.

Aluminum:

Aluminum barrier films are favored for their exceptional barrier properties against moisture, light, and gases, making them ideal for packaging sensitive food products. They are often used in applications requiring a long shelf life, such as snack foods, dairy products, and frozen meals. Aluminum packaging provides a robust solution for preserving flavor and freshness while preventing spoilage. The recyclability of aluminum is another factor driving its demand in the food packaging market, as consumers increasingly seek sustainable packaging options. Ongoing advancements in aluminum film technology are expected to enhance its performance and expand its applications within the food sector.

Biodegradable Films:

The demand for biodegradable films is on the rise as consumers and manufacturers alike become more environmentally conscious. These films are designed to break down naturally over time, reducing their impact on landfills and the environment. Biodegradable barrier films are being developed using various materials, including starch-based polymers and PLA (polylactic acid), offering suitable barrier properties for food packaging. As regulatory pressures increase to reduce plastic waste, the adoption of biodegradable films is likely to gain momentum in the food packaging sector. This segment represents a significant opportunity for innovation, as manufacturers strive to create effective biodegradable solutions that meet the needs of the market.

Paperboard:

Paperboard is increasingly being used in the food packaging sector due to its sustainable nature and ability to provide a good barrier against moisture and grease. It is commonly utilized for packaging applications such as cartons and boxes for various food products, including snacks, frozen foods, and beverages. With consumers becoming more aware of sustainability issues, paperboard packaging is gaining traction as a preferred alternative to plastic. The use of barrier coatings on paperboard allows for improved product protection while maintaining the material's eco-friendly attributes. As manufacturers continue to innovate with sustainable packaging solutions, the adoption of paperboard in food packaging is expected to grow.

Others:

This category includes a variety of innovative materials that are being developed for food packaging applications, such as multilayer films and custom-engineered polymers that enhance barrier properties. Manufacturers are increasingly exploring new material combinations to create films that offer enhanced durability, flexibility, and sustainability. As the food packaging industry evolves, the demand for unique materials that can cater to specific food product needs is likely to rise. The development of advanced materials that contribute to improved food preservation and sustainability will play a crucial role in shaping the future of the food packaging barrier film market.

Threats

Despite the promising growth prospects of the food packaging barrier film market, several threats could impede its progress. One of the primary concerns is the fluctuating prices of raw materials used in the production of barrier films. Price volatility in petroleum-based materials, such as polyethylene and polypropylene, can affect manufacturing costs and, consequently, profit margins for producers. As raw material prices rise, manufacturers may be forced to pass those costs on to consumers, potentially leading to a decline in demand for packaged products. Moreover, the push towards sustainability may require significant investments in developing alternative materials, which could strain financial resources and operational capabilities.

Another potential threat stems from the increasing regulatory scrutiny surrounding packaging materials, particularly concerning environmental impact. Governments are enacting stricter regulations aimed at reducing single-use plastics and promoting sustainable practices. While this shift presents opportunities for the development of eco-friendly materials, it also poses challenges for companies that rely heavily on traditional plastic barrier films. Adapting to changing regulations may require considerable resources and time, placing additional pressure on manufacturers to innovate rapidly. Compliance with various regional regulations can also complicate supply chains, leading to increased costs and potential disruptions.
